Bi系氧化物超导体中的掺Ag

Doping of Silver in Superconducting Oxides of Bismuth Series

摘要 本文利用低温电阻测定、XRD、EDX、SEM等方法,研究了掺Ag对Bi系超导体的超导性能、输运特性的影响,以及Ag在超导体中的存在形式。结果表明,Ag不仅分布于晶界上,而且还进入了超导相的晶格中。它促使了高温相的分解,从而导致超导性能、特剐是输运特性的恶化。 The effect of doping of silver in oxides of bismuth series on the superconducting and transferring properties of the superconducting oxides was studied by means of low temperature resistance determination,XRD,EDX and SEM.Also studied were the forms of silver existing in the superconducting oxides.It was shown by the results that silver not only exists on grain boundaries but also penetrates into crystal lattices,which accelerates the high temperature decomposition of phases and leads to the deterioration of the superconducting and transferring properties.
